Each chair is offered individually, and while both sport the original leather sling and patina from their age, each has had leatherwork completed to ensure long term use, including, but not limited to, new straps in high stress areas, new nylon cord stitching to prevent breaks, and conditioning throughout. Additionally, the pine frame has been oiled, tightened and gone over for the next owner.
32 1/2" W | 23 1/2" D | 27" H | 10 1/2" Seat Height (bottom of sling)
